The Maine Warden Service says the body of an Indian Island man who fell into the Kenduskeag Stream has been recovered.

The man has been identified as 41-year-old John Nadeau. At around 5:30 Sunday afternoon Nadeau and Sumer Francis, also of Indian Island, went to the stream to take a picture. While standing on a platform, overlooking the Kenduskeag Stream, Nadeau stepped over the protective railings, lost his balance, and went into the water.

Bangor Police and Fire, along with the Maine Warden Service and DEEMI Search and Rescue immediately began looking for Nadeau, but finally had to suspend the search when it got dark. Divers went back into the water early Monday morning, and he was finally found by a Warden Service diver at around 8:45 a.m., at the bottom of the stream, not far from where he went in.

The State Medical Examiner's office was notified and Nadeau was taken to Brookings and Smith Funeral Home in Bangor.
